5 strategies to boost sales in your Wix store

In a digital landscape ruled by innovation and competitiveness, online stores hosted on platforms like Wix are constantly in search of efficient strategies to stand out and boost their sales. Immersing themselves in the depths of an ever-changing market, it’s crucial to adopt methods based on data, advanced analytics, and a refined understanding of consumer behavior. This article breaks down five advanced strategies to propel sales in Wix stores, bringing a technical and specialized approach.

Strategy 1: User Experience (UX) Optimization

A customer’s first impression is often the most impactful. UX on Wix should be both intuitive and rewarding. To achieve this, it’s essential to conduct usability audits that evaluate navigation, load speed, and information architecture. Tools such as Google PageSpeed Insights and WebPageTest provide performance metrics that can reveal critical bottlenecks in load speed, while A/B testing can help refine the placement and design of interface elements.

Fast Page Loading

An optimized page load reduces abandonment rates. Implementing techniques like ‘lazy loading’, image compression, and minification of CSS and JavaScript files can significantly improve load times. Additionally, adopting new image formats like WebP for efficient and rich graphics can be fundamental in user retention.

Responsive Design and Adaptability

Adaptive design is an undeniable requirement in the mobile era. Wix stores must ensure consistency and accessibility across a variety of devices, using CSS media queries and breakpoints to adjust to different screen sizes.

Strategy 2: Advanced SEO and Content Analysis

To capture organic traffic, it’s crucial that Wix stores implement advanced SEO practices, ranging from keyword research using tools like Ahrefs or SEMrush, to technical optimization of the site.

Keywords and Long Tail SEO

Identifying and utilizing less competitive, long-tail keywords can capture specific market niches. Analyzing search intent and aligning content with the users’ specific questions and needs can increase conversion rates.

Metadata Optimization

Titles and meta descriptions that strategically incorporate keywords and generate curiosity can significantly improve the Click-Through Rate (CTR) from search engines. Consistency between metadata and page content is fundamental to maintaining relevance and meeting user expectations.

Strategy 3: Specialized Content Marketing

Creating content that not only attracts but also retains and converts is essential. This involves developing material that not only focuses on selling but also educates, entertains, and solves problems.

Blogging and E-books

An effective blogging strategy can establish authority within the niche, while e-books and other forms of downloadable content add value for the user and provide lead capture opportunities through subscriptions.

Video Marketing

Video content explodes in terms of engagement and conversion. Implementing product demonstration videos, testimonials, and educational content can increase dwell time on the site and foster consumer trust.

Strategy 4: Personalization and Audience Segmentation

Personalization is the key to connecting with users on a deeper level. Using data analytics tools and CRM, Wix stores can segment their audience and personalize their communication and offers.

Personalized Email Marketing

Emails that use user behavior and preference data to tailor the message are more effective. Advanced segmentation based on past purchase activity or site interaction can result in highly effective campaigns.

Smart Product Recommendations

The use of machine learning algorithms and big data enables offering personalized recommendations to customers, based on their browsing and purchase history, increasing the relevance of the products shown and the likelihood of conversion.

Strategy 5: Data-Driven Analysis and Optimization

Strategic decisions must be driven by accurate and current information. Implementing web analytics tools such as Google Analytics provides a deep understanding of performance metrics.

Conversion Tracking and Funnel Analysis

It’s crucial to track each step in the conversion funnel to identify where users are dropping off and to optimize those points of friction. Advanced analytics can reveal insights into how to improve the shopping experience.

Multivariate Testing

Implementing multivariate testing allows evaluating the performance of different versions of the same page or element in real-time, maximizing the chances of detecting the most effective option to increase sales.

By combining these five strategies, Wix stores can not only improve their position in the digital market but also provide exceptional shopping experiences. This holistic and data-driven approach leads to continuous optimization, customer satisfaction, and, ultimately, sustainable sales growth.
